From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.3 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, MAILING_LIST_MULTI,RCVD_IN_DNSWL_MED aut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 28865 invoked from network); 8 Apr 2023 17:36:04 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 8 Apr 2023 17:36:04 -0000 ARC-Seal: i=2; cv=pass; a=rsa-sha256; d=zsh.org; s=rsa-20210803; t=1680975364; b=R/XY56zMwecqeYqlu3A63EbrmSyu+Eh5JAmqkne2Q1uaI/alwoUrRYFCB4pudhVcGgCDZM7rW8 ksKMc8fD0e2bobjBe9Y9HsqycxuhljUoe3C+xR/Kkf76RvxOxcLzXYrN50Cy4sIveQellFqRcA jD1fo7OtmC80vlRX/8En0f6DLcLVdIVNpi2MIndnmeMCm0K0cpHgW5mXupqMPewsJz2aOyWvy/ W4gMctsisy+i0pEec7QEN0cY4CH4qAPkefqs6bUXOUXR6osxhi5fCQxRmzkApLgIus6M4HtIDd 1xnjA+VrpQW2/GE4pFcrtHVaD/XOUyB0AzASYmZk2FQm1Q==; ARC-Authentication-Results: i=2; zsh.org; iprev=pass (dog.elm.relay.mailchannels.net) smtp.remote-ip=23.83.212.48; dkim=pass header.d=easesoftware.com header.s=default header.a=rsa-sha256; dmarc=none header.from=easesoftware.com; arc=pass (i=1) header.s=arc-2022 arc.oldest-pass=1 smtp.remote-ip=23.83.212.48 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20210803; t=1680975364; bh=MBlghflrFaCJZaYBk1CizvF2YArB7Fv2+ivJ4hTdSa0=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:To:References:Message-ID:Cc:Date:In-Reply-To:From:Subject: MIME-Version:Content-Type:DKIM-Signature:DKIM-Signature; b=aO0duJJ4eYLb8lprBism6l9rAL+k+pJsbr9HCeZ9y5IloxPkCgirS2E21WvHbrWk0Vmf4eLaid pZpGdNkXfLWCCQUMZcXc49wdAjYzRRnCnJr/y2dZ5HTDiZbzv/cBF3MdA7fKmAQvW96izj9zlw Sb0k+dgu+4eSV9VuNk5Zkp2iIeHVMb4LEqyHFd9cz/+GRqQhXKURWnnc4NahmwlmPmDk9s/3vK 1ztUv3z7uAdUu98/LDIsYtOpvpAtDUTauNzGjDHnIRAdRG+F3895QSmvwFRg/893r0Ahy86igw Qw+Qbu7ZRi/CPcjiJJIz6wxlSg98YeKiU6XC6I9gebBNsA==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20210803;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:To:References:Message-Id:Cc:Date: In-Reply-To:From:Subject:Mime-Version:Content-Type:Reply-To: Content-Transfer-Encoding: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ID; bh=WLPQkK+qO3pzvojOT0Mvs6biEGwlY7muMzG2M6+ATRE=; b=jYrrY9QqJdD7dDhDgjjAGzXPAm 8FT6YC6dCk/PZIRSFalxyYUHhYCwNFBndKVAZ0dW6h+CRqSgpbkWEIi0OToHkGZEc9nyy0b14bmgD w7+5SObqePvgeqvc2b2naIk6dI/g/Oxeq8qmAMA65Xzb59RoexZW/mZB4SV6EQm/E4xXtLKwtdAND eBlaXy4HzRtmWHKqdLSQcto4vFHa1N/po9HQCAy5690ya612OJOOsXlrbJUKJEb/GdL1zWy9M/n+Z fvf/y9lYWC9WzaL3WW0DJeYYS8FsZcEkyNLorgiNXTWnszI0go3GyS/cwkZngduybDGxIXSxc2O3z DSzdq1tg==; Received: by zero.zsh.org with local id 1plCTr-0002WV-KW; Sat, 08 Apr 2023 17:36:03 +0000 Authentication-Results: zsh.org; iprev=pass (dog.elm.relay.mailchannels.net) smtp.remote-ip=23.83.212.48; dkim=pass header.d=easesoftware.com header.s=default header.a=rsa-sha256; dmarc=none header.from=easesoftware.com; arc=pass (i=1) header.s=arc-2022 arc.oldest-pass=1 smtp.remote-ip=23.83.212.48 Received: from dog.elm.relay.mailchannels.net ([23.83.212.48]:28914) by zero.zsh.org with esmtps (TLS1.2:ECDHE-RSA-AES256-GCM-SHA384:256) id 1plCTF-0001pl-09; Sat, 08 Apr 2023 17:35:26 +0000 X-Sender-Id: a2hosting|x-authuser|pedz+easesoftware.com@mi3-ss4.a2hosting.com Received: from relay.mailchannels.net (localhost [127.0.0.1]) by relay.mailchannels.net (Postfix) with ESMTP id 048D78229BA; Sat, 8 Apr 2023 17:35:23 +0000 (UTC) Received: from mi3-ss4.a2hosting.com (unknown [127.0.0.6]) (Authenticated sender: a2hosting) by relay.mailchannels.net (Postfix) with ESMTPA id 455C98229D0; Sat, 8 Apr 2023 17:35:22 +0000 (UTC) ARC-Seal: i=1; s=arc-2022; d=mailchannels.net; t=1680975322; a=rsa-sha256; cv=none; b=wHz9yBk/+/P4FgITgSIEP+uZ9wVzgAUTa0rq3cjJ0HqEMzYCJb+LMyghtWgMF9rry8kIfG guCHQVn7AeKvT9yIEvc/vTp6NyuQ5ojaV7EWb2g5xSbPvoo/WOethkw0exQr6p/Nugow2U 6yglrBxO+W4Ha4eJR43Jx8WqfMyZsIAfEccPzD5aHpYktcMVjJlLdCCDDzJPLdSvdpckvW pqHiHIlifWW5K2eQa9vD3TGc1SMLXGJlx+A7GFacmgq2bLD6nojSKnP3eGPNAtcrJBh1eL 1IWV5kCYzZ3n6n+VTff4bCVaWXvUFbYg77h6uaK4t+bG7uJohNYQnn0v0wqgAg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=mailchannels.net; s=arc-2022; t=1680975322;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references:dkim-signature; bh=WLPQkK+qO3pzvojOT0Mvs6biEGwlY7muMzG2M6+ATRE=; b=DpShZiZqB8du5kfVMZleyIBzFWE5uHQeFLjYnH2h1bI43T3HRM0baSRogyq/M9clrJUkTh 4f3iRmzE+5+LAUs4w3qjUB9JAt/h61kenimuY29WLnFS9sUp7uinSnEb3WJ0sLkfy09/U9 rSZr7BM7EE/CVKIutPjsxbzkokvniAi27wiTaTHxZBwXtiiWVwQiQF48eifX3qnvaUZAUH ESNP+S3t4KID2jnfum3ekU3M7qcuHa4sNoCXYv9Srku+lJt56NVev8Hz0XqBP3a7qUmH0q 7VKnTFZ7P0xZk/rHhSnXVIGXgI2DEqLr/OEh5vTTzRJeuo+gc4hzxkuVBFZ5vw== ARC-Authentication-Results: i=1; rspamd-5468d68f6d-m7zzl; auth=pass smtp.auth=a2hosting smtp.mailfrom=pedz@easesoftware.com X-Sender-Id: a2hosting|x-authuser|pedz+easesoftware.com@mi3-ss4.a2hosting.com X-MC-Relay: Neutral X-MailChannels-SenderId: a2hosting|x-authuser|pedz+easesoftware.com@mi3-ss4.a2hosting.com X-MailChannels-Auth-Id: a2hosting X-Descriptive-Bubble: 3dd036bd781d5fb6_1680975322771_1983176466 X-MC-Loop-Signature: 1680975322771:756211224 X-MC-Ingress-Time: 1680975322771 Received: from mi3-ss4.a2hosting.com (mi3-ss4.a2hosting.com [68.66.200.199]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384) by 100.102.66.14 (trex/6.7.2); Sat, 08 Apr 2023 17:35:22 +0000 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=easesoftware.com; s=default; h=To:References:Message-Id:Cc:Date:In-Reply-To :From:Subject:Mime-Version:Content-Type:Sender:Reply-To: Content-Transfer-Encoding: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ID:List-Id: List-Help:List-Unsubscribe:List-Subscribe:List-Post:List-Owner:List-Archive; bh=WLPQkK+qO3pzvojOT0Mvs6biEGwlY7muMzG2M6+ATRE=; b=PkpcfbpJ/Eo704KI5G1LTrIZNF PMvAPIhUCci4b2UcY906Bmkb1m3e5shwRJvRmctaqHC8aleRj8i9T5qSgfgqEfWGmq4qNWepZ7cO/ 6h7vMnx6Dyr9eQNPHp/Gs2PD+xsJa5tq7UE8ZWkNNptodowAy4cWdtPhB825PfpcWhyXenEHTFCcU l9YTpCp1G2TNnH2ZMdt4MobwYL0wI12BAdN3rSY0Rjn1QLM2lJ+BkzCJyPHDtsyfTfSCskWtwTLKM LSJMFH0yQ7iVRlJAKuStY9u5bAXcRk3L6QpZyfLR79C7osUw/y2W68D9l07EMejee6s6VJFeUCFZD MlFhwsvQ==; Received: from [70.94.128.193] (port=49458 helo=smtpclient.apple) by mi3-ss4.a2hosting.com with esmtpsa (TLS1.2)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1plCTA-0007NK-3D; Sat, 08 Apr 2023 13:35:21 -0400 Content-Type: multipart/signed; boundary="Apple-Mail=_E9890DCD-A98F-4F6A-B9BA-EA8D6BA0BD42"; protocol="application/pgp-signature"; micalg=pgp-sha256 Mime-Version: 1.0 (Mac OS X Mail 16.0 \(3731.500.231\)) Subject: Re: .zsh_history From: Perry Smith In-Reply-To: Date: Sat, 8 Apr 2023 12:35:09 -0500 Cc: Ray Andrews , zsh-users@zsh.org Message-Id: <720C7A28-A3CD-4EDC-A8AB-52F56F02BD49@easesoftware.com> References: <81609CF4-42DA-4E0F-A6E5-C5D58578B4F7@easesoftware.com> To: Roman Perepelitsa X-Mailer: Apple Mail (2.3731.500.231) X-AuthUser: pedz+easesoftware.com@mi3-ss4.a2hosting.com X-Seq: 29014 Archived-At: X-Loop: zsh-users@zsh.org Errors-To: zsh-users-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-users-request@zsh.org X-no-archive: yes List-Id: List-Help: , List-Subscribe: , List-Unsubscribe: , List-Post: List-Owner: List-Archive: --Apple-Mail=_E9890DCD-A98F-4F6A-B9BA-EA8D6BA0BD42 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 > On Apr 8, 2023, at 12:27, Roman Perepelitsa = wrote: >=20 > On Sat, Apr 8, 2023 at 7:23=E2=80=AFPM Ray Andrews = wrote: >>=20 >> On 2023-04-08 09:53, Roman Perepelitsa wrote: >>>=20 >>> Yes. If you exit all shells, you'll have history from all of them >>> saved within $HISTFILE. >>>=20 >> I can't remember if it's stock or something I cobbled together for >> myself, but my history is updated in real time, I don't need to exit. >=20 > Indeed, there are options that do this. All options are described in > `man zshoptions`. >=20 > Perry's options (which I've quoted in my original reply) require him > to exit zsh before history is written. Yea. I=E2=80=99ve seen those options. Generally that isn=E2=80=99t my = pain point. It is (was) Apple=E2=80=99s session stuff and not having = history from long ago. Thank you all --Apple-Mail=_E9890DCD-A98F-4F6A-B9BA-EA8D6BA0BD42 Content-Transfer-Encoding: 7bit Content-Disposition: attachment; filename=signature.asc Content-Type: application/pgp-signature; name=signature.asc Content-Description: Message signed with OpenPGP -----BEGIN PGP SIGNATURE----- iQIzBAEBCAAdFiEE5yOa/gCtQpb3oCpljxzk9yzE+MAFAmQxpc0ACgkQjxzk9yzE +MCubQ//WHmYHBoRQHSqZQ/CAHZOE4b4f/u5DMm5d9mOXE+KfTxwrlg/sJ5DO+2e FCQYJ+LhnIOUU59AnP3kZ6p7jcCWaBDkpf7Wfu/LAoP0Gkxx9qtsBqJ4zbvpvFeZ UOcvHz8ZP7Kb9AdlGmbDpfU1PuGPaQHP+RA6MBZVE9e+oyuwP3LwNSIXgYfoeTH6 NOswWkyxWs4/Sykwuzr0tJxoZKr+FyGBITZtPUPf8oivP01inr0eGBuOi55J4xT5 hkSVd5Mkr2zljDIIotV5p5oF6+Op2Pnpa5Hwqh9otpDS2KMbx2wUp1M/J8WPv+ON eeHgus2H9wBFmy7rnW3ErBTe5M8uSrV/tK22vT6t7Hd97wqvYjunO8YL79t3/5hU 5txvu1WgDxrpPQQS/5AKo0yGQ5wf+dbtfZPcX9BFIvEt6ilJyXEXSOk5RXco75qz 9bYUeZesPtOmHwTJTgy570b/KJ0EtrgocDh1/PFYIxLGMS7llaSUOtKAd+hD6F77 QG1aR/xvpTrVv3f0+LzUzRVG4+6MmrmOfCcOhbLHy2FCVYb59Q6Zj3kDr5unkbKr o58qqRJJ5k3nhSwdXKurhw9n+CGYMtK+ZTraYXSR4q/eSS7bypgOeelLNAZ+Mlho D4zDFiKOVIL0f4bm3hLpEyM+QSB5ckJXG7s9G9WCXuZxvYKa0lM= =NUu5 -----END PGP SIGNATURE----- --Apple-Mail=_E9890DCD-A98F-4F6A-B9BA-EA8D6BA0BD42--